Did you not even read up on UofT before you sent in your application? Yes, first-year full-time students are guaranteed a spot in residence as long as you’ve actually applied to a res. So if you haven’t, you have until the end of the month.

And well, there are no actual “required” courses. For the most part, in first year you can take whatever you feel like (provided you have the prerequisites). Since you’re in chemical and physical sciences, I assume you want to specialize/major/whatever in chemical and/or physics at the end of the year. If that’s the case, you’ll probably want to take CHM151Y OR the CHM138H/CHM139H combo. And if you’re keen on physics, PHY151H and PHY152H. Basically, take a look at the possible programs you can enter at the end of your first year and then work with the 100-level courses they want you to take.
